Avocado, garlic, fresh dill, lemon juice, and buttermilk create a powerhouse dressing for a simple salad of butter lettuce, cucumber, and radishes. Crumbled bacon adds a welcome smoky note.

Steps:
- Combine avocado, garlic, dill, lemon juice, buttermilk, and 2 tablespoons water in a blender; puree until smooth. Season with salt and pepper. (If dressing is too thick, add more water, a tablespoon at a time.)
- Toss together lettuce, cucumber, bacon, and radishes in a large bowl; season with salt and pepper. Drizzle with 1/4 cup dressing. Serve remaining dressing on the side, or refrigerate in an airtight container up to 2 days.
